The University of Strathclyde is happy to announce the Faculty of Science Masters Scholarships for International Students for the January 2025. This scholarship aims to support new international students pursuing a full-time MSc in Advanced Computer Science, Advanced Computer Science with Data Science, or Advanced Computer Science with Software Engineering.
The University of Strathclyde, located in Glasgow, Scotland, was founded in 1796 as the Andersonian Institute, making it one of the oldest technical institutions in the UK. It gained university status in 1964 and has since evolved into a leading institution known for its commitment to research, innovation, and student success. The university is recognized for its strong focus on practical learning and has a diverse community of students from around the world, offering a wide range of undergraduate and postgraduate programs across various disciplines.

Eligibility Criteria
To qualify for the Faculty of Science Masters Scholarship, applicants must meet the following criteria:
- New International Student: Applicants must be new, international fee-paying students.
- Admission Offer: Hold an offer of admission for a full-time place in one of the eligible MSc programs for the January 2025 intake.
- Self-Funded: Students must be self-funded and cannot receive full scholarships from external sources (e.g., government or embassy).
- Outstanding Academic Performance: Demonstrate excellent academic performance (current and/or previously gained) and relevant extracurricular or professional experience.
Benefits
- Value: The scholarship awards range between £5,000 to £7,000.
- Purpose: The funds will be applied toward tuition fees and cannot be used for deposits.
- Notification: Successful candidates will be notified within four weeks of receiving their admission offer.
- Engagement Requirement: Recipients are expected to participate in student ambassador activities throughout their studies.
Application Process
- Admission Offer: To apply for the scholarship, candidates must first secure an offer of admission to one of the specified MSc programs.
- Application Form: A link to the scholarship application form will be provided via email or included in the offer letter.
- Submission: Complete the application form and submit it by the scholarship deadline.
